Until Heaven Calls (1980)

Distraught that he is unable to go to his parent's home for the holidays, Sang-do gets drunk and meets a beautiful woman, but he winds up spending the night in the hospital after being beaten by her boyfriend. Upon being discharged, he finds a blank check on the sidewalk and is torn between following his conscience or his greed.

Director: Lee Won-se
Genre: Drama
Runtime: 95 min
